diff options
| author | Patrick Mochel <mochel@osdl.org> | 2002-07-31 22:24:41 -0700 |
|---|---|---|
| committer | Patrick Mochel <mochel@osdl.org> | 2002-07-31 22:24:41 -0700 |
| commit | 9e27f077152b4aa70184166406eed14005a83faa (patch) | |
| tree | 74d8c57e5efb6ffdefcd5e9766ba56a58d24d6f0 /include | |
| parent | 137973c1a3ee75e3d28af550a5e33737ac9acc5b (diff) | |
| parent | 8a24c0b94488c734eddee9d07e61adcbe441919f (diff) | |
Merge osdl.org:/home/mochel/src/kernel/devel/linux-2.5-virgin
into osdl.org:/home/mochel/src/kernel/devel/linux-2.5-driverfs-api
Diffstat (limited to 'include')
| -rw-r--r-- | include/asm-i386/smp.h |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/include/asm-i386/smp.h b/include/asm-i386/smp.h index 6b116b38a4e2..a6d46dec1d09 100644 --- a/include/asm-i386/smp.h +++ b/include/asm-i386/smp.h @@ -85,7 +85,9 @@ extern volatile int logical_apicid_to_cpu[MAX_APICID]; */ #define smp_processor_id() (current_thread_info()->cpu) -#define cpu_possible(cpu) (phys_cpu_present_map & (1<<(cpu))) +extern volatile unsigned long cpu_callout_map; + +#define cpu_possible(cpu) (cpu_callout_map & (1<<(cpu))) #define cpu_online(cpu) (cpu_online_map & (1<<(cpu))) extern inline unsigned int num_online_cpus(void) @@ -113,7 +115,6 @@ static __inline int logical_smp_processor_id(void) return GET_APIC_LOGICAL_ID(*(unsigned long *)(APIC_BASE+APIC_LDR)); } -extern volatile unsigned long cpu_callout_map; /* We don't mark CPUs online until __cpu_up(), so we need another measure */ static inline int num_booting_cpus(void) { |
